Please tell us about the good and bad aspects of living in your local area:
Stratford is generally a very good area to live in. It has excellent transport links with several underground and rail lines. Our favourite is the Elizabeth Line - it is new, comfortable and, in our opinion, the cleanest. There is also a large shopping centre nearby with a wide variety of shops, so everything you might need is close at hand. The area itself is divided into New Stratford and Old Stratford. We live in New Stratford and feel very comfortable and safe here. Old Stratford feels more mixed and sometimes less safe, but overall our experience living here has been very positive.
How has the building management responded to any problems or issues you have raised:
We had a great experience with the maintenance staff during our move-in, especially Val. He was extremely helpful and quickly resolved all minor issues we noticed when entering the new apartment. He also assisted us with the equipment and made sure everything was working properly. Val was very fast, professional, polite, and well-organized. All our questions and requests were handled efficiently and with great attention to detail. We truly appreciate his support - the entire process was smooth and stress-free thanks to his excellent work.
Please share one thing (or more) which you wish you had known before you moved in:
Overall, the viewing process was clear and we felt that everything was explained well before we moved in. One thing that would have been helpful to know in advance is that if you want to book certain shared spaces or private rooms within the building, this comes at an additional cost. At the same time, all common areas provided by the building are free to use, which is great. Another small practical point is storage: the wardrobe is quite spacious, but it is not internally organised, so you may need to buy additional shelves or organisers. This is not a major issue, but it was a bit challenging at the beginning, as we moved in with four suitcases and organising a completely empty wardrobe took some time.

Please tell us about the good and bad aspects of living in your local area:
For those by the river the views are delight. Security concerns are excellent and the cared for green and colourful spaces around the development are somewhat unique, upmarket and joyful. Quick access to supermarkets, street market, shops, eateries and a variety of transport options is a convenient bonus. The opening of the Elizabeth Line makes this a very desirable place to live.
Please share one thing (or more) which you wish you had known before you moved in:
Service charges seem high but compare favourably against other London Boroughs.
What is the best feature of your home:
Magnificent views, lovely grounds. Woolwich Works and Punchdrunk Theatre add greatly to the cultural ambiance.

Please tell us about the good and bad aspects of living in your local area:
The location is unbeatable. You have Coal Drops Yard right on your doorstep with endless options for food and shopping, and a Waitrose nearby for groceries. The transport links at King's Cross and St Pancras are obviously world-class, making it so easy to get anywhere in London or hop on the Eurostar. The canal walks are a lovely bonus for a weekend stroll.
How has the building management responded to any problems or issues you have raised:
Management has been very responsive. I haven't had many maintenance issues, but the one small query I had was sorted out the same day. The team, especially Mr. X, really seem to care that residents are happy and comfortable.
Please share one thing (or more) which you wish you had known before you moved in:
I loved the outward facing units. If someone requires a quite view, there are ample number of garden facing options as well.

Please tell us about the good and bad aspects of living in your local area:
I would say, avoid! The building doesn't have any facilities or common areas where to work or spend some time. The laundry room has 4 washing machines and 4 dryers, always dirty and quite expensive. They said bills included, but don't expect Internet and council and wait for £140 for energy and water for one person, no matter summer or winter. Transport and places to get a take away are plenty, but I never felt safe in the area, let alone the building surroundings where people shoot drugs on the disposable area and search on others rubbish every night (you will hear them while trying to sleep.
How has the building management responded to any problems or issues you have raised:
It was OK. I never had anything to ask. They always new if I was in or not.
Please share one thing (or more) which you wish you had known before you moved in:
More about the area and the fact that the room walls are very thin.
